Peter Reginato (b. 1945) is an abstract sculptor and painter. His work is organic and biomorphic, using color to add a painterly effect. Reginato’s sculptures are comparable to the drawings of Henri Matisse in a three-dimensional format.

Born in Texas, Peter Reginato attended the San Francisco Art institute from 1963-66. His work was included in the Whitney Biennial in 1970 and 1973, and is I. the permanent collections of The Corcoran Gallery of Art, The Metropolitan Museum of Art, The Corcoran Gallery of Art, and The Museum of Fine Arts, Boston, among others.
